Feldspar - Chemical composition | Britannica
Chemical composition. All the rock-forming feldspars are alumino silicate minerals with the general formula AT 4 O 8 in which A = potassium, sodium, or calcium (Ca); and T = silicon (Si) and aluminum (Al), with a Si:Al ratio ranging from 3:1 to 1:1. Microcline and orthoclase are potassium feldspars (KAlSi 3 O 8), usually designated Or in discussions involving their end-member composition.

Igneous Minerals - Union College
Hint: to highlight K-feldspar, switch to a medium or low magnification objective (usually 4 or 10X works well), mostly close the substage iris, and raise the stage slightly (yes, raise). Though the image will be somewhat out of focus, the low index K-feldspar grains will be surrounded by bright Becke lines just inside the grain boundaries.

Feldspar - Wikipedia
Compositions of major elements in common feldspars can be expressed in terms of three endmembers: potassium feldspar (K-spar) endmember K Al Si 3 O 8, albite endmember NaAlSi 3 O 8, anorthite endmember CaAl 2 Si 2 O 8. Solid solutions between K-feldspar and albite are called "alkali feldspar".

Feldspar Distinctions, Characteristics & Identification
Aug 10, 2019· This mineral is often called potassium feldspar or K-feldspar because potassium always exceeds sodium in its formula. Potassium feldspar comes in three different crystal structures that depend on the temperature it formed at. Microcline is the stable form below about 400 C. Orthoclase and sanidine are stable above 500 C and 900 C, respectively.

Gallery of Feldspars - ThoughtCo
Feldspars lie along one of two solid-solution series, the plagioclase feldspars and the alkali or potassium feldspars. All of them are based on the silica group, consisting of silicon atoms surrounded by four oxygens. In the feldspars, the silica groups form rigid three-dimensional interlocking frameworks.

pics of feldspar
The feldspars are divided into two main groups: Potassium feldspar ("K-spar") and plagioclase ("plag"). Both display two cleavages and an overlapping range of colors, but only plagioclase displays tiny grooves on one cleavage known as striations. The photos below show several examples of feldspar. Orthoclase ( Potassium) feldspar
Sanidine occurs in potassium-rich volcanic rocks such as rhyolite and trachyte. Orthoclase is the characteristic potassium feldspar of igneous rocks, occuring both alone and in perthitic intergrowth with albite; it also occurs in some metamorphic rocks. The variety adularia is formed at comparatively low temperatures, typically in veins.
